Yes. Johnstown's Sold Score of 66/100 in May 2026 (Good Chance of Selling) means demand is outrunning supply enough that motivated sellers are getting deals done.
Pending ratio is 0.90 — the higher this is, the faster contracts come in relative to standing inventory. Active inventory is up +18.3% year over year, expanding the pool you're competing in. Median days on market sit at 47. 37.0% of active listings have already reduced asking price.
